In-House Marketing Coordinator

We Put the World on Vacation Travel + Leisure Co. is the world’s leading vacation ownership and travel membership company, with a dynamic and growing portfolio of resort, travel club, and lifestyle travel brands. Our dedicated associates help the company achieve its mission to put the world on vacation. Innovation and growth keep our work interesting and fun. Every day is a chance to learn something new and turn vacation inspiration into exceptional experiences for millions of travelers worldwide.

Job Summary

In person marketing with prospective and/or current owners within our resorts. Schedules guests to meet with a representative for a presentation.

Essential Job Responsibilities

  • Serve as a positive and professional brand ambassador for Wyndham Destinations
  • Partner with the resort staff to receive arrival sheets of guests checking in
  • Greet, present, and incentivize prospective customers to attend a sales-preview tour
  • Screen and qualify potential customers based on company guidelines
  • Make sales-tour reservations and collect required deposits

Compensation

During the initial training period, the hourly wage is $18.50 plus commissions and bonuses. After the initial training period, the compensation is the state’s minimum wage per hour, plus commissions and bonuses.
